Honeycomb Datasets API
A Dataset represents a collection of related events that come from the same source, or are related to the same source.This API allows you to list, create, and update datasets.## AuthorizationThe API key must have the **Create Datasets** permission. This API exposes 5 operations across 2 paths, and defines 7 schemas. It is described by OpenAPI 3.1.0, at version 1.0.0.
Requests are made against 2 base URLs: https://api.honeycomb.io, https://api.eu1.honeycomb.io.
